2004 House Bill 5649

Introduced in the House

March 16, 2004

Introduced by Rep. Matthew Gillard (D-106)

To require the Michigan Natural Resources Trust Fund board to give priority to the purchase of severed mineral rights on state land if the land has recreational uses, environmental importance or scenic beauty that would be adversely affected by the exploration or production of subsurface minerals.

Referred to the Committee on Conservation and Outdoor Recreation
